What Is IEC 61850 Standard?

First, let’s break down what IEC 61850 really means. IEC 61850 is an international standard that sets the rules for communication in power systems. Think of it as a universal language that helps different electrical devices talk to each other seamlessly.

This standard emerged from a real need. Power substations used to have many different brands of equipment, and they couldn’t communicate well with each other. IEC 61850 changed everything by creating a common communication protocol.

Key aspects of IEC 61850:

  • Standardized communication: Devices from different manufacturers now speak the same language
  • Improved reliability: Better communication means fewer errors and faster response times
  • Enhanced automation: Substations can now automate complex tasks without manual intervention
  • Reduced installation costs: Engineers spend less time configuring incompatible systems

Before we continue, let’s clarify what a protection relay does. A protection relay detects electrical faults and sends signals to disconnect the faulty circuit. This happens in milliseconds, preventing equipment damage and ensuring safety.

The Technical Innovation Behind IEC 61850 Integration

Let’s understand the technical side of how this works. The Schneider MiCOM P438 Protection Relay uses IEC 61850-compliant communication protocols to exchange information. This includes GOOSE (Generic Object Oriented Substation Event) messages for fast, critical signals.

GOOSE messages are special. They transmit critical protection signals in under 4 milliseconds. This ultra-fast communication ensures that protection actions happen before faults can cause damage.

Technical specifications:

  • GOOSE message speed: Less than 4 milliseconds transmission time
  • Redundancy options: Supports multiple communication paths for reliability
  • Cybersecurity measures: Includes authentication and encryption protocols
  • Standards compliance: Fully adheres to IEC 61850 part 8-1 requirements
  • Backward compatibility: Works with older systems when bridging is needed

Increased System Reliability

The coordinated protection enabled by IEC 61850 reduces nuisance trips. When relays can communicate, false alarms decrease dramatically. Consequently, the power system experiences fewer unnecessary outages. This means customers enjoy better service continuity and higher satisfaction.

Reduced Operating Costs

Think about the money saved. First, reduced outages mean less revenue loss for utilities. Second, predictive maintenance prevents expensive emergency repairs. Third, automated protection reduces the need for on-site technicians. Together, these factors create substantial cost savings over time.

Faster Fault Location and Isolation

When a fault occurs, IEC 61850-enabled relays quickly pinpoint the problem location. Moreover, the system can automatically isolate only the affected circuit while keeping the rest of the network online. This selective protection minimizes blackout areas and duration.

Easier System Expansion

Adding new equipment becomes simpler. IEC 61850 provides a standard framework, so new devices integrate smoothly. Additionally, engineers don’t need to redesign protection schemes when expanding the network. This accelerates infrastructure development and reduces project costs.
